Description | NAA-004, also known as APAZA, has been shown to significantly inhibit toxin A-induced myeloperoxidase activity, luminal fluid accumulation, and structural damage to the colon in instances of toxin A-induced colitis. |
Molecular Weight | 300.27 |
Formula | C15H12N2O5 |
CAS No. | 402934-69-4 |
